Android平台电商App购物车示例解压缩指南

需积分: 5 2 下载量 22 浏览量 更新于2024-10-18 收藏 32.67MB RAR 举报
资源摘要信息:"1_yzj_电商demo.rar" 知识点一:Android电商平台开发 1. 定义与概述:Android电商平台是基于Android操作系统开发的移动电子商务应用程序,允许用户通过手机购买商品和服务。 2. 核心功能:主要包括商品浏览、搜索筛选、购物车管理、订单处理、支付接口集成、用户评论、在线客服等。 3. 开发技术栈:Android电商平台通常采用Java或Kotlin作为编程语言,配合Android Studio进行开发,使用XML布局界面,后端则可能采用Java、Python或PHP等语言,数据库通常选用MySQL或MongoDB等。 知识点二:购物车功能实现 1. 购物车概念:购物车是电商应用中一个非常核心的功能,它允许用户在浏览过程中将感兴趣的商品暂时保存起来,以便一次性结账。 2. 实现原理:通常购物车数据存储在本地数据库或服务器中,与用户账户系统绑定,通过一系列的增删改查操作实现商品的添加和数量修改。 3. 功能细节: - 商品添加:用户点击添加到购物车按钮,将商品信息存储在购物车列表中。 - 商品数量修改:用户可以修改购物车中商品的数量,可能有最大数量限制。 - 商品删除:用户可以从购物车中删除商品。 - 小计与总价:计算所有选中商品的总价,并提供优惠、折扣等信息。 - 结账:将购物车中商品信息发送到服务器进行订单处理。 知识点三:Android应用打包与发布 1. 打包过程:开发者通过Android Studio对应用进行编译打包,生成一个或者多个APK文件,这些文件包含了应用的所有代码和资源。 2. 发布准备:在发布前需要对应用进行签名,以确保应用的安全性。签名是通过密钥库(keystore)和密钥(key alias)来完成的。 3. 发布渠道:Android应用主要通过Google Play Store发布,也可以选择其他第三方应用市场或者自行分发APK文件。 知识点四:电商demo应用特点 1. 演示性质:名为"demo"的应用通常是用来展示功能或者作为开发过程中的测试版,不包含全部商业产品的全部功能。 2. 功能限定:电商demo应用可能仅包含部分电商功能,例如商品展示、购物车添加等,以帮助开发者理解如何构建电商平台的某一部分。 3. 学习与教学:这类应用经常作为教学工具或示例,帮助初学者快速了解Android电商平台的开发流程和结构。 综合以上信息,1_yzj_电商demo.rar是一个示例性的Android平台电商应用压缩包,它可能包含一个简化的购物车功能和基本的商品管理功能,通过这个demo,开发者能够学习和理解如何构建一个Android电商平台的基本框架和关键功能模块。